Understanding the roulette Wheel and Its Variations
the roulette wheel is an iconic element of the game, captivating players with its vibrant colors and the thrill of spinning fortunes. Understanding its layout is essential for any aspiring player. The classic European roulette wheel has 37 pockets, numbered from 0 to 36, while the American version features 38 pockets with the addition of a double zero. This slight difference significantly impacts the house edge: 2.7% for the European wheel and 5.26% for the American wheel. Familiarizing yourself with the wheel will enhance your gameplay and strategy.
Each variation of roulette offers unique betting options and experiences, making it crucial to know what you’re playing. Here’s a speedy overview of some popular roulette types:
- European Roulette: One zero pocket, lower house edge.
- American Roulette: Includes a double zero, higher house edge.
- French Roulette: Similar to European but features unique betting rules like “La Partage.”
- Mini Roulette: A simplified version with only 13 numbers, faster gameplay.
Understanding these characteristics can help you make informed choices, thereby shaping your overall strategy and improving your chance of success.
Key Betting Strategies for Maximizing Your Odds
to enhance your chances of winning at roulette, consider adopting a discipline-first approach.This involves setting clear limits on your bankroll—both for losses and winnings—to avoid the pitfalls of chasing losses or gambling impulsively. establish a specific budget for each session and stick to it, as this will help you maintain control over your betting activities. Here are a few strategies that you can implement:
- The Martingale System: This progressive betting strategy involves doubling your bet after each loss with the expectation that a win will eventually recover all previous losses.
- The Fibonacci Strategy: This method uses the Fibonacci sequence to determine your bet sizes, increasing your bets gradually after losses to recover from them more strategically.
- The D’Alembert System: A balanced approach where you increase your bet by one unit after a loss and decrease it by one unit after a win, aiming to create equilibrium in your bankroll.
While each of these strategies can provide a structured approach to betting, it’s crucial to understand that no system can guarantee wins due to the inherent house edge. Therefore, focusing on betting types that offer better odds is equally vital. By selecting outside bets, such as red or black, odd or even, you increase your chances of winning, albeit with lower payouts. A comparative overview of payouts and odds can be useful:
Bet Type | Payout | Winning Odds |
---|---|---|
Red/Black | 1:1 | 48.6% |
Odd/Even | 1:1 | 48.6% |
Low/High (1-18/19-36) | 1:1 | 48.6% |
Single Number | 35:1 | 2.6% |
